Skip to content

Commit

Permalink
fix!: header consensus (#4527)
Browse files Browse the repository at this point in the history
Description
---
Fix header consensus encoding

How Has This Been Tested?
---
  • Loading branch information
SWvheerden authored Aug 24, 2022
1 parent e89ffac commit 3f5fcf2
Showing 1 changed file with 8 additions and 8 deletions.
16 changes: 8 additions & 8 deletions base_layer/core/src/blocks/block_header.rs
Original file line number Diff line number Diff line change
Expand Up @@ -412,12 +412,12 @@ impl ConsensusEncoding for BlockHeader {
self.height.consensus_encode(writer)?;
copy_into_fixed_array_lossy::<_, 32>(&self.prev_hash).consensus_encode(writer)?;
self.timestamp.consensus_encode(writer)?;
self.output_mr.as_slice().consensus_encode(writer)?;
self.witness_mr.as_slice().consensus_encode(writer)?;
self.output_mr.consensus_encode(writer)?;
self.witness_mr.consensus_encode(writer)?;
self.output_mmr_size.consensus_encode(writer)?;
self.kernel_mr.as_slice().consensus_encode(writer)?;
self.kernel_mr.consensus_encode(writer)?;
self.kernel_mmr_size.consensus_encode(writer)?;
self.input_mr.as_slice().consensus_encode(writer)?;
self.input_mr.consensus_encode(writer)?;
self.total_kernel_offset.consensus_encode(writer)?;
self.total_script_offset.consensus_encode(writer)?;
self.nonce.consensus_encode(writer)?;
Expand All @@ -435,12 +435,12 @@ impl ConsensusDecoding for BlockHeader {
header.height = u64::consensus_decode(reader)?;
header.prev_hash = <[u8; 32] as ConsensusDecoding>::consensus_decode(reader)?.to_vec();
header.timestamp = EpochTime::consensus_decode(reader)?;
header.output_mr = FixedHash::from(<[u8; 32] as ConsensusDecoding>::consensus_decode(reader)?);
header.witness_mr = FixedHash::from(<[u8; 32] as ConsensusDecoding>::consensus_decode(reader)?);
header.output_mr = FixedHash::consensus_decode(reader)?;
header.witness_mr = FixedHash::consensus_decode(reader)?;
header.output_mmr_size = u64::consensus_decode(reader)?;
header.kernel_mr = FixedHash::from(<[u8; 32] as ConsensusDecoding>::consensus_decode(reader)?);
header.kernel_mr = FixedHash::consensus_decode(reader)?;
header.kernel_mmr_size = u64::consensus_decode(reader)?;
header.input_mr = FixedHash::from(<[u8; 32] as ConsensusDecoding>::consensus_decode(reader)?);
header.input_mr = FixedHash::consensus_decode(reader)?;
header.total_kernel_offset = BlindingFactor::consensus_decode(reader)?;
header.total_script_offset = BlindingFactor::consensus_decode(reader)?;
header.nonce = u64::consensus_decode(reader)?;
Expand Down

0 comments on commit 3f5fcf2

Please sign in to comment.